Alaska Mix Nasturtium Seeds | Edible Flowers & Leaves | Heirloom/Non-GMO

Descripción

Alaska Mix Nasturtium produces green and white variegated foliage with brilliant, single, 2" flowers in orange, yellow, salmon, and red. Alaska Mix Nasturtium has a fairly compact growth habit, making it perfect for patio containers, hanging baskets, and window boxes. The flowers and tender young leaves of Alaska Mix Nasturtium add color and a peppery zip to salads. The variegated foliage, green with white streaks, is the outstanding feature of Alaska Mix Nasturtium. The highly ornamental foliage is covered with pert, spurred flowers in orange, yellow, salmon, and red. Alaska Mix Nasturtium is an especially striking edging for flowerbeds or borders.
  • Botanical Name: Tropaeolum Minus

  • Life Cycle: Annual

  • Light Requirement: Full Sun, Partial Shade

  • Planting Season: Spring

  • Plant Type: Trailing Vines and Abundant Variegated Round Leaves with Multicolored Petals

  • Features: Heirloom, Attracts Pollinators, Edible, Fragrant, Easy to Grow & Maintain, Container Garden

  • Color: Mixed

  • Blooms: Summer

  • Days to Maturity: 60 Days

  • Plant Height: 10-12 inches

  • Plant Spacing: 4-6 inches

  • Planting Depth: 1/2 inch

  • Sowing Method: Direct Sow

  • Cold Stratification: No

  • Hardiness Zones: 1, 2, 3, 4, 5, 6, 7, 8, 9, 10
